We are looking for an organised and enthusiastic HR Administration Apprentice to join our HR team.

This is an excellent opportunity for someone looking to begin a career in Human Resources while completing a CIPD Level 3 qualification.

The role will provide administrative support across recruitment, onboarding, employee records, absence management, training and general HR activities.

Key responsibilities

  • Maintain accurate employee records, personnel files and HR systems.
  • Prepare contracts, offer letters and other HR documentation.
  • Support the group recruitment processes.
  • Assist with pre-employment checks, new-starter documentation and inductions.
  • Support the administration of absence, probation and performance-management processes.
  • Arrange employee meetings and prepare relevant letters and documentation.
  • Take accurate meeting notes when required.
  • Maintain training records and assist with coordinating training courses.
  • Respond to general employee queries and provide administrative support to the HR team.
  • Complete all learning and assessments required for the CIPD Level 3 apprenticeship.

About you

  • A genuine interest in developing a career in HR.
  • Good written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ong organisational skills and attention to detail.
  • Basic knowledge of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ook and Teams.
  • Able to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information appropriately.
  • A positive attitude and willingness to learn.

Previous HR experience is not essential, as full training and support will be provided.
